Am I really almost half way there? In the first 12 days, so much has happened. Those of you receiving prints this week will receive them in my new rigid self-sealing mailers. On the inside sandwiched between two pieces of chip board with a Stonetrigger Press sticker on the front you will find a crystalclear brand glassine print holder. I am now printing out all my labels directly from Etsy via the USPS. We are growing up fast here at Stonetrigger Press; it is not really  “we” unless you include Conrad and Homer who are not helpful. I am looking at other ways to streamline my mailing because I have 10-15 orders to send out each day before I start carving my blocks. I love packing up stuff so you will continue to see changes. Also feel free to make suggestions! I am strongly considering extending this to 90 days so I need to become the queen of efficiency.

Many people order a few times during the week. I do not want you to pay multiple shipping charges. I can do 1 of 2 things. You can email me prints that you want and I will put a “reserve” on Etsy for you. We can add to that “reserve” listing, then settle up at the end of the week or every two weeks. I can also hold your order and when you order more refund the shipping cost. It makes sense to just send the whole package priority, a whole pound of prints can fit. Until I figure out a better solution I think the reserve will work best.

Ideally I will ship the day after the order, but often time prints need to dry 3 days, then ship on the 4th day. I listed on Etsy that I would mail them 1-3 business days, but I just changed that to 3-5 days. Most likely I will still send them within 1-3 business days.
